Healthy Hidden Veggie Banana Chocolate Chip Mini Muffins

Delicious mini muffins packed with hidden vegetables, perfect for breakfast or snacks. A sweet combination of bananas and chocolate chips that kids will love!
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 24 mini muffins
Course: Breakfast, Snack
Cuisine: American
Calories: 80

Ingredients
  

Dry Ingredients
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our (or whole wheat pastry flour) Use whole wheat for added nutrition
  • 1/2 cup oat flour
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
Wet Ingredients
  • 3 pieces ripe bananas, mashed
  • 2 pieces large eggs, room temperature Can substitute with flax eggs or unsweetened applesauce for egg-free
  • 2 tablespoons honey (or maple syrup for vegan option)
  • 1/4 cup plain Greek yogurt (or dairy-free yogurt)
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Add-ins
  • 1 cup finely grated zucchini (squeezed to remove excess moisture) Ensure zucchini is well-drained
  • 3/4 cup mini chocolate chips (dark or semi-sweet)

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ease your mini muffin pan or line it with mini paper liners.
  2. Grate 1 cup of zucchini finely and squeeze out as much moisture as possible using a clean kitchen towel or paper towel.
  3. In a large bowl, mash the ripe bananas until mostly smooth. Add the eggs, honey, Greek yogurt, and vanilla extract. Whisk gently but thoroughly to combine.
  4. In a separate b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, oat flour,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t.
  5. Slowly add the dry ingredients to the wet banana mixture, stirring gently with a spatula. Do not overmix; the batter should be thick but a bit lumpy.
  6. Gently fold in the grated zucchini and chocolate chips, distributing evenly but carefully.
Baking
  1. Spoon the batter into the mini muffin cups, filling each about 3/4 full (this makes about 24 mini muffins).
  2. Bake for 12-15 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ean or with just a few crumbs.
  3. Let the muffins cool in the pan for 5 minutes, then transfer to a cooling rack to cool completely.

Notes

Store the cooled muffins in an airtight container for up to 3 days at room temperature. For longer storage, refrigerate for up to a week or freeze for up to 3 months. Thaw at room temperature or warm briefly in the microwave before enjoying. Tips include using whole wheat flour and mixing in add-ins like nuts or dried fruits for variety.
